Difference Between Normal Gmail ID and Domain Email ID
1. Email Address Format
2. Professionalism
- Normal Gmail ID:
Looks personal. Not ideal for official or business use.
- Domain Email ID:
Looks professional and trustworthy. Best for business branding.
3. Branding
- Normal Gmail ID:
No branding—only shows Gmail.
- Domain Email ID:
Promotes your business name in every email.
4. Ownership
- Normal Gmail ID:
Owned by Google. You have limited control.
- Domain Email ID:
Owned by you/your business because it uses your domain.
5. Customization
- Normal Gmail ID:
Cannot customize the domain name.
- Domain Email ID:
Fully customizable (support@, sales@, contact@, etc.).
6. Storage & Features
- Normal Gmail ID:
Standard Gmail features with limited free storage.
- Domain Email ID:
Comes with Google Workspace or hosting email features, more storage, better management.
7. Team Use
- Normal Gmail ID:
For single-person use.
- Domain Email ID:
Best for teams—can create multiple accounts and manage users.
